Delight in the captivating handicraft of woodturning! Join our exceptional woodturning instructors to experience a hands-on, foundational introduction to woodturning, no experience required! Students will learn about the basic equipment and specific tools and techniques used in woodturning, while turning their first samples. With a focus on lathe safety, supply and tool selection, cutting techniques, and tool sharpening skills, instructors will walk you through the steps to rough turn square stock, form a tenon, and cut grooves, beads, and coves to create spindle-turned projects.

Bring an impact-resistant face shield (shared classroom shields are also available for use), and closed-toe shoes.
